The Role of Private Psychiatrists
Private psychiatrists are certified doctor who concentrate on identifying and dealing with mental diseases, emotional problems, and addicting disorders. They offer a series of services that empowers patients to find the right therapeutic path fit to their distinct experiences.

The very first assessment with a private psychiatrist can be an anxious experience for numerous. However, knowing what to anticipate during this see can assist alleviate your issues.
Typical Agenda of a First Visit:
StepDescriptionPreliminary AssessmentTalking about individual history, family background, and present mental health issues-- this generally lasts between 60-90 minutes.Establishing Treatment GoalsCollaboratively setting brief and long-term objectives for your therapeutic journey.Possible ReferralThe psychiatrist might advise extra screening or referrals to other specialists if required.Treatment Plan DiscussionDeveloping an initial treatment strategy, including therapy options, diagnostic examinations, and medication management if required.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

2. What should I give my very first visit?
It is a good idea to bring any relevant medical history files, a list of medications you're presently taking, and a record of your symptoms. Some clients find it helpful to write down their thoughts and concerns prior to the conference.
3. Will my insurance cover consultations with a private psychiatrist?
Insurance protection varies by plan. It is essential to confirm with your insurance coverage provider concerning mental health advantages and whether specific private professionals accept your insurance.

4. How numerous sessions will I require?
The number of sessions varies depending upon specific needs. Some clients might find relief in simply a few sessions, while others may require long-term care. Your psychiatrist will help direct this process.
5. Can I see a private psychiatrist without a referral?
For the most part, a recommendation is not necessary to see a private psychiatrist. Nevertheless, some insurance coverage strategies might need one, so it's vital to check before setting up a consultation.
